There’s nothing more frustrating
than a sluggish computer, but rather than buying a new laptop or PC, here are 5
ways of avoiding a costly new purchase by making your slow computer run
faster.
Step 1: Reboot Slow Computer
After restarting/rebooting the
computer, whatever what was stuck on the computer before will no longer be
frozen on the screen.
Step 2 : Uninstall Unused Programs
New computers come with many
programs that go unused and unnoticed. To remove all these pointless programs,
open the Control Panel’s Programs and Features page, and have a trawl through
the list of installed software. Uninstall do not need.
Step 3: Check RAM
RAM, which stands for Random Access
Memory, is the temporary storage memory used by the computer. Therefore, the
more programs used, the more RAM needed. The slower the computer will be if
there isn’t enough RAM.
A clear indicator of not having
enough RAM is if the computer slows down every time you try and process large
files. It may also freeze while carrying out several different actions at once.
Add more RAM by buying an extra
memory stick or two, or buy getting completely new memory if all the slots are
taken.
